Transaction 1c60383ca176ec859821da142a62df137ce886e827653aea4f16a80cf170cd61
1 Input
1 Output
-
1c60383ca176ec859821da142a62df137ce886e827653aea4f16a80cf170cd61:0
- value
- 108577
- script pubkey
- OP_0 OP_PUSHBYTES_20 803a21eaf213cb03659f510dbbf72b3a8147798a
- address
- bc1qsqazr6hjz09sxevl2yxmhaet82q5w7v28vcsyj